No support for the Sybase TIMESTAMP native datatype? ----------------------------------------------------
Key: DDLUTILS-262 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/DDLUTILS-262 Project: DdlUtils Issue Type: Improvement Components: Core - Sybase Reporter: Shant Bozian Assignee: Thomas Dudziak I am using the Ddlutils API to migrate a database model from Sybase to Oracle. I noticed that there isn't anything in DdlUtils that recognizes the TIMESTAMP datatype in Sybase. When going from Sybase to Oracle, timestamp is converted to raw(8). Then, when going back from Oracle to Sybase, raw(8) is converted back to varbinary, as there is no special field in the model to tell this was an original Sybase TIMESTAMP column. So far so good, so I tried to modify the database model in the code and set the desired TIMESTAMP type wherever necessary, but that wasn't possible neither as there is no JDBC datatype which corresponds to the Sybase TIMESTAMP native datatype!
